Understanding Intestinal Health and Why It Matters

Gut health serves as a cornerstone of overall wellness, affecting not only digestive health but also immune response and mental health. The gastrointestinal tract is the habitat of trillions of microorganisms, collectively termed the gut microbiome, which play a critical role in sustaining bodily functions. A well-balanced gut microbiome supports breaking down food, absorbing nutrients, and producing vital vitamins. Furthermore, it contributes to the immune system, acting as a barrier against harmful microorganisms.

Research suggests that gut health is tied to mood and cognitive functions, indicating a bidirectional relationship between the gut and brain. Dysbiosis, or an imbalance of gut bacteria, can lead to digestive disorders, autoimmune diseases, and even mental health issues like anxiety and depression. As a result, understanding and prioritizing gut health is vital for overall health, emphasizing the need for lifestyle choices that support a healthy microbiome.

Understanding Fermented Foods

Fermented foods are products created through fermentation, where microorganisms like bacteria, yeasts, or molds transform sugars and starches into acids or alcohol. This time-honored method both enhances the flavors of foods but also preserves them, lengthening their shelf life. Common examples include yogurt, sauerkraut, kimchi, kefir, and kombucha. These foods often possess a unique tangy taste and a complex aroma that sets them apart from their non-fermented counterparts.

The fermentation process also contributes to the nutritional profile of these foods, making them more digestible and enriching them with bioactive compounds. Additionally, fermented foods have earned recognition for their potential health benefits, especially regarding gut health. They are often associated with enhanced digestive processes and strengthened immune function. Therefore, including fermented foods into daily eating habits can be a practical approach to support overall well-being and foster a balanced gut microbiome.

The Scientific Foundation of Probiotics

What renders probiotics crucial for preserving a healthy microbiome? Probiotics are living microorganisms that deliver health improvements when ingested in sufficient amounts. They play an essential role in stabilizing the gut microbiota, which contains trillions of bacteria that support digestion, immune function, and overall health. Scientific studies have shown that probiotics can help reestablishing gut flora, particularly after disturbances triggered by antibiotics or illness.

This beneficial bacteria competes with dangerous pathogens for nutrients, thus preventing their development. Probiotic organisms also create short-chain fatty acids and additional metabolites that reinforce gut barrier function and decrease inflammatory responses. Furthermore, they can enhance the absorption of nutrients and vitamins. Understanding the mechanisms by which probiotics interact with the gut microbiome highlights their significance in promoting digestive health and maintaining homeostasis within the gastrointestinal tract. Optimized Digestive Function

Incorporating fermented foods into one's diet can remarkably enhance digestive health. These probiotic-packed foods help bring back the natural balance of gut bacteria, facilitating proper digestion. By breaking down food more effectively, they can relieve symptoms of bloating, gas, and discomfort. In addition, fermented foods like yogurt, kefir, and sauerkraut can aid in nutrient absorption, seeing to it that essential vitamins and minerals are effectively utilized by the body. Frequent consumption can also decrease the risk of gastrointestinal disorders, such as irritable bowel syndrome and constipation. In summary, integrating fermented foods into regular meals can produce improved gut function, enhancing overall well-being and contributing to a healthier digestive system.

Strengthened Immune Health

Though various factors affect immune health, the addition of fermented foods in the diet has been found to substantially boost immune function. These foods, rich in probiotics, contribute to a well-balanced gut microbiome, which plays a vital role in the body's immune response. The advantageous bacteria found in fermented products such as yogurt, kefir, and sauerkraut help manage immune activity, potentially reducing the occurrence of infections and inflammatory diseases. Additionally, fermented foods are often rich in vitamins and antioxidants, which support overall health and may aid the immune system. By regularly including these foods into daily meals, individuals can foster a more strong immune system, eventually leading to better well-being and a lower risk of illness.

Necessary Ingredients

Preparing probiotic yogurt at home needs a few essential ingredients that work together to grow beneficial bacteria. The primary ingredient is milk, which can be regular, skim, or non-dairy alternatives like almond or coconut milk. The choice of milk influences the yogurt's texture and flavor. Next, a yogurt starter culture is essential; it contains live active bacteria, such as Lactobacillus bulgaricus and Streptococcus thermophilus, which ferment the milk. Furthermore, temperature control is necessary, so having a thermometer ensures the milk is heated and maintained at the correct temperature for optimal fermentation. Sweeteners like honey or maple syrup can improve flavor, while optional flavorings, such as vanilla or fruit, can be added to tailor the yogurt to individual preferences.

Detailed Preparation Steps

Preparing probiotic yogurt at home entails a straightforward process that permits individuals to enjoy the positive effects of beneficial bacteria. First, one should heat milk to around 180°F (82°C) to remove unwanted bacteria, then cool it to around 110°F (43°C). Once cooled, a starter culture containing live active cultures is added, typically using commercially available yogurt as a base. The mixture is completely stirred to achieve even distribution. Then, the yogurt should be transferred to a clean container, covered, and placed in a warm environment for fermentation, where it will thicken and develop its characteristic tangy flavor. After fermentation, the yogurt can be kept in the refrigerator, ready to be eaten as a nutritious addition to one's diet.

Tips for Fermentation Time

How long should fermentation take for ideal results? A fermentation period of 6 to 12 hours is recommended for homemade probiotic yogurt. The specific time varies based on the desired tartness and thickness. Higher temperatures generally speed up the fermentation process, while lower temperatures may extend it. It is recommended to inspect the yogurt regularly, especially after the initial 6 hours, to assess its development. Milder flavors require shorter fermentation periods, while longer durations create a tangier yogurt. Furthermore, keeping a stable temperature around 110°F (43°C) ensures optimal bacterial activity. After fermentation, refrigerating the yogurt halts the process, enhancing its flavor and texture for enjoyable consumption.

Innovative Methods to Enjoy Homemade Yogurt

Homemade yogurt often serves as a versatile ingredient in multiple culinary applications. It can be used as a creamy base for salad dressings, providing both tang and probiotics to salads. By merging yogurt with herbs and spices, one can create flavorful dips, suitable for pairing with vegetables or whole-grain crackers. In baking, yogurt can replace oil or butter in recipes, contributing moisture while lowering fat content.

Additionally, it works beautifully in smoothies, delivering a protein boost and a tangy flavor that complements fruits. Yogurt can also enrich soups and stews, adding a creamy texture without the heaviness of cream. For breakfast, it can be layered with fruits, nuts, and granola to create a nourishing parfait. Additionally, homemade yogurt can be frozen in molds, transforming it into a rejuvenating treat during warmer months. These versatile uses demonstrate yogurt's adaptability in a health-conscious kitchen.

Strategies for Maintaining a Healthy Gut Outside of Fermented Foods

Besides adding yogurt and other fermented foods into the diet, individuals can implement several strategies to support gut health. A balanced diet packed with fiber is crucial, as it feeds beneficial gut bacteria. Whole grains, fruits, and vegetables should be emphasized to enhance digestion. Staying hydrated is also important; water helps with the absorption of nutrients and helps related information sustain the mucosal lining of the intestines.

Routine physical exercise enhances gut health by encouraging healthy digestion and decreasing stress levels. Limiting processed foods and added sugars can prevent the overgrowth of harmful bacteria. Attentive eating techniques, such as properly masticating food and eating slowly, can enhance digestion. Additionally, managing stress through approaches like meditation or yoga fosters a healthier gut environment. Together, these strategies create a well-rounded approach to maintaining gut health, reinforcing the benefits of fermented foods.

Is Store-Bought Yogurt Suitable as a Starter Culture?

Yes, store-bought yogurt can be used as a starter culture. It should contain live active cultures, which aid in the fermentation of the milk. However, utilizing homemade yogurt can produce better and more consistent results over time.

What Is the Refrigerator Storage Time for Homemade Fermented Foods?

Homemade fermented products usually last anywhere from one to three weeks in cold storage, contingent upon the type and storage conditions. Ensuring proper hygiene and temperature assists in prolonging their flavor and freshness over this timeframe.

What Indicates That Fermentation Has Been Successful?

Successful fermentation is indicated by bubbles forming, a tangy aroma, and changes in appearance or consistency. Additionally, a sour flavor generally indicates active fermentation, while an absence of spoilage verifies the process was effective and safe.

What Risks Are Associated With Eating Fermented Foods?

Consuming fermented foods does come with certain risks. This includes potential allergic reactions, elevated histamine production, and contamination with pathogenic bacteria if appropriate hygiene and fermentation practices are not followed during preparation.
